Teddy Long says that while he’s still open to working for WWE from time to time, he isn’t interested in returning to the company full-time.

Speaking on a recent edition of the “Inside the Ropes” podcast, the WWE Hall of Famer shot down any rumors that he’d be returning as a “General Manager” for RAW or SmackDown.

You can check out some highlights from the podcast below:

On not returning as General Manager: “I’m not coming back to be a GM. I’m coming back to be a part of the draft or whatever else they want me to do.”

On not having plans to return full-time: “I’m not there to try and be full-time anymore, I really don’t want that. I just want to enjoy the rest of my life.”
